2. Moderating Home Prices, Not Major Declines
After several years of rapid appreciation, home prices in Leonia are expected to stabilize rather than drop dramatically.
Inventory remains tight, but as more sellers reenter the market, we’ll likely see:
📊 Slower, more sustainable price growth
🤝 Increased balance between buyers and sellers
🏠 Continued competition for updated or well-located properties
In other words—Leonia is shifting toward a more normal, data-driven market rather than a frenzied one.
3. Mortgage Rate Adjustments Will Shape Buyer Activity
Interest rates continue to influence market momentum. If rates ease slightly (as many economists anticipate), expect:
📈 A boost in buyer confidence
🔑 More first-time buyers reentering the market
🏡 Continued movement among homeowners looking to upsize or downsize
If rates stay steady, Leonia’s market should remain active but measured—favoring serious, qualified buyers ready to act.
4. Inventory Growth Will Bring New Opportunities
Leonia’s inventory levels have remained relatively low in recent years, but 2025 may bring gradual increases as homeowners regain confidence in selling.
This creates opportunity for:
✅ Buyers who’ve struggled with limited choices
✅ Sellers ready to stand out with move-in-ready listings
✅ Investors seeking long-term value in a prime location
More listings mean more negotiation power on both sides—and a healthier market overall.
